

INspired INsider Podcast
Dr. Jeremy Weisz
INspiredINsider.com Show with Dr. Jeremy Weisz features interviews with successful and inspirational entrepreneurs, authors, and visionary leaders.
The interviews reveal deeply personal stories and
explore the tough journey of Big Challenges or Big Mistakes that the inspirational leaders overcame to achieve success.
Here are some inspiring stories you will find:
- Jonny Imerman with Imerman Angels--Listen to how one guest fought and beat cancer. He then started an organization to match others to help battle cancer by providing one on one mentorship with someone who has already battled and beat that same cancer. It is one of the largest organizations of its kind in the world.
--Jordan Guernsey Founder of MoldingBox--How did the CEO and founder of a multimillion dollar company handle both personally and professionally being diagnosed with Stage 3 Melanoma. He said it was the best thing that ever happened to him.
There are also featured interviews with the founders of SkyMall, Wistia, Noah's Bagels (Einsteins) and many more!
Thank you for listening from your host, Dr. Jeremy Weisz.

[Top Agency Series] The Magic of Direct Response and AI in Nonprofit Growth With Mike Nellis
Mike Nellis is the Founder of Authentic, a marketing agency that specializes in online fundraising, media, and creative design, and has helped raise over $1 billion online. With a deep-rooted political background, including work for Barack Obama's presidential campaign, Mike possesses a profound understanding of engaging communities and stakeholders digitally. He's also the Founder of Quiller.ai, an Adweek 2023 AI Efficiency Award-winning tool designed to revolutionize online fundraising using generative AI technology. In this episode… In the competitive world of online fundraising and political campaigns, staying ahead of the curve and maintaining a healthy organizational culture are crucial. Many organizations struggle with staff burnout, ineffective marketing strategies, and the relentless pace of technological change. Addressing these challenges requires both a deep understanding of the industry and a willingness to innovate. Mike Nellis, fundraising and AI expert, is pioneering the space with his focus on authenticity and culture. By studying the successes of the Obama campaign, Mike recognized early on the power of personal connections and authenticity in online fundraising. He took this learning and started Authentic, where he emphasized nurturing a positive work environment and avoiding the pitfalls he experienced at other workplaces. Moreover, Mike embraced the future by founding Quiller.ai, which leverages AI to streamline fundraising efforts and combat burnout. In this episode of Inspired Insider Podcast, host Dr. Jeremy Weisz sits down with Mike Nellis, Founder of Authentic and Quiller.ai, to discuss the intersection of AI and online fundraising. The two touch on utilizing email marketing tactics to elevate campaign strategies, the value of developing solid systems and processes for business efficiency, Mike's journey from Obama's campaign to founding a leading marketing agency, and the cultural shift toward a four-day workweek.

[Top Agency Series & SaaS Series] Reaching Consumers On-the-Go With Casey Binkley of Movia Media
Casey Binkley is the Founder and CEO of Movia, a company helping brands maximize their advertising results with a unique combination of mobile ads and technology. Movia installs tracking and Wi-Fi collecting devices onto trucks acting as moving billboards, offering real-time impression analytics and retargeting opportunities. Casey is also the Founder of Mobilytics, a leading measurement and analytics provider for the out-of-home advertising industry. With his background in entrepreneurial studies, he excels at identifying opportunities and helping businesses get off the ground. In this episode… Out-of-home advertising has been a popular and effective marketing strategy for decades. It is a type of advertising that targets consumers outside their homes by utilizing methods such as billboards, posters, trucks, and digital displays. However, it requires a strategic approach to execute it effectively. Serial entrepreneur Casey Binkley believes in the potential of OOH advertising, as it can reach a large and diverse audience. Unlike other forms of advertising limited to specific channels, it is accessible to everyone, regardless of demographics or interests. Through a unique combination of mobile ads through trucks and technology, he shares how he's made OOH advertising more interactive and engaging, allowing brands to connect with their audiences on a deeper level. In this episode of the Inspired Insider Podcast, Dr. Jeremy Weisz chats with Casey Binkley, Founder and CEO of Movia, to discuss how he helps brands thrive through OOH advertising. Casey talks about the genesis of Movia Media and Mobilytics, mobile billboard advertising tech development and execution, and customer success stories.
